3D Printing in Oral Surgery
To enhance the area of oral surgery, you can explore the subtopic of 3D printing in oral surgery. This cutting-edge technology has the prospective to revolutionize the means oral specialists operate and treat clients. Below are four essential ways in which 3D printing is shaping the field:
- ** Customized Surgical Guides **: 3D printing permits the production of very exact and patient-specific surgical overviews, boosting the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, oral surgeons can develop personalized implant prosthetics that flawlessly fit an individual's special anatomy, leading to better outcomes and individual fulfillment.
-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, reducing the need for standard grafting methods and improving healing and recovery time.
- ** Education and learning and Educating **: 3D printing can be utilized to produce sensible surgical models for instructional functions, enabling oral specialists to practice complex procedures before doing them on individuals.

Minimally Intrusive Methods
To further advance the field of dental surgery, welcome the possibility of minimally intrusive strategies that can substantially benefit both specialists and patients alike.
Minimally invasive strategies are revolutionizing the area by lowering surgical injury, minimizing post-operative pain, and accelerating the healing process. These techniques involve using smaller lacerations and specialized tools to execute treatments with precision and efficiency.
By utilizing innovative imaging technology, such as cone beam calculated tomography (CBCT), specialists can properly intend and implement surgical procedures with minimal invasiveness.
In addition, the use of lasers in oral surgery enables exact cells cutting and coagulation, causing minimized blood loss and reduced recovery time.
With minimally intrusive methods, people can experience faster recuperation, minimized scarring, and enhanced outcomes, making it an essential aspect of the future of dental surgery.
